Two Sisters (Traditional) |
|---|
|
There was an old woman lived by the seashore Bow and balance to me There was an old woman lived by the seashore A number of daughters: one, two, three, four And I'll be true to my love if my love will be true to me There was a young man come there to see them Bow and balance to me There was a young man come there to see them And the oldest one got stuck on him And I'll be true to my love if my love will be true to me He bought the youngest a beaver hat Bow and balance to me He bought the youngest a beaver hat And the oldest one got mad at that And I'll be true to my love if my love will be true to me Oh, sister oh, sister let's walk the seashore Bow and balance to me Oh, sister oh, sister let's walk the seashore And see the ships as they're sailing on And I'll be true to my love if my love will be true to me While these two sisters were walking the shore Bow and balance to me While these two sisters were walking the shore The oldest pushed the youngest o'er And I'll be true to my love if my love will be true to me Oh, sister oh, sister please lend me your hand Bow and balance to me Oh, sister oh, sister please lend me your hand And you will have Willy and all of his land And then I'll be true to my love if my love will be true to me I'll never, I'll never will lend you my hand Bow and balance to me I'll never, I'll never will lend you my hand But I'll have Willy and all of his land And I'll be true to my love if my love will be true to me Some time she sank and some time she swam Bow and balance to me Some time she sank and some time she swam Until she came to the old mill dam And I'll be true to my love if my love will be true to me The miller he got his fishing hook Bow and balance to me The miller he got his fishing hook And fished that maiden out of the brook And I'll be true to my love if my love will be true to me Oh, miller oh, miller here's five gold rings Bow and balance to me Oh, miller oh, miller here's five gold rings To push the maiden in again And I'll be true to my love if my love will be true to me The miller received those five gold rings Bow and balance to me The miller received those five gold rings And pushed that maiden in again And I'll be true to my love if my love will be true to me The miller was hung in the old mill gate Bow and balance to me The miller was hung in the old mill gate For drowning little sister Kate And I'll be true to my love if my love will be true to me |
